Soft Count Supervisor - Casino supervises soft count personnel and activities. Reconciles the soft count summary report with the information entered into the computer. Being a Soft Count Supervisor - Casino prepares work schedules and maintains proper staffing. Ensures the integrity of the soft count and compliance with gaming regulations. Additionally, Soft Count Supervisor - Casino may require a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. The Soft Count Supervisor - Casino supervises a small group of para-professional staff in an organization characterized by highly transactional or repetitive processes. Contributes to the development of processes and procedures. Thorough knowledge of functional area under supervision. To be a Soft Count Supervisor - Casino typically requires 3 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Position Summary: performs tasks related to the drop, collection, transportation, and counting of cash and tickets from gaming operations in accordance with regulated procedures and Internal Controls.
